ANCHORAGE, Alaska — Alaska’s Mount Redoubt continued to erupt Saturday, sending one ash plume 50,000 feet into the air. The Alaska Volcano Observatory in Anchorage said the volcano had a significant eruption at 1:20 a.m. Saturday and two less powerful eruptions in the afternoon.
Alaska Airlines, the state’s largest carrier, canceled eight flights early Saturday, but since then operations had been fairly normal, said spokesman Paul McElroy.
